Wagering Requirements and Bonus Terms
One of the most crucial aspects of any casino bonus, including the vegas hero bonus, is the wagering requirement. This refers to the amount of money a player needs to wager before they can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. A 35x wagering requirement, for instance, means you must wager 35 times the bonus amount before your winnings become eligible for withdrawal. These requirements are in place to prevent players from simply depositing a small amount, claiming the bonus, and withdrawing the funds immediately. Always read the bonus terms and conditions closely to understand the specifics of the wagering requirement, including any time limitations. It is advisable to determine whether any games have a lower weighting toward the fulfilling of these requirements.
- Game Restrictions: Some games may contribute less (or not at all) towards fulfilling the wagering requirement.
- Time Limits: Bonuses often have an expiry date, after which the bonus and any winnings are forfeited.
- Maximum Bets: Casinos may impose a maximum bet size while the bonus is active.
- Excluded Payment Methods: Certain payment methods may not be eligible for claiming a bonus.
Understanding Game Contributions
Not all casino games contribute equally towards meeting wagering requirements. Generally, slots contribute 100%, meaning the full amount wagered counts towards the requirement. However, table games such as blackjack and roulette typically contribute a much smaller percentage, often around 10% or even less. This is because these games generally have a lower house edge, making it easier for players to win. It is imperative to understand these game contributions before claiming a bonus, especially if you prefer playing table games. Players should carefully review the bonus terms to discover these contributions, since they can sometimes vary across casinos.

Securing Your Account – Best Practices
Protecting your online casino account is paramount. With the increasing sophistication of online threats, it is important to take steps to safeguard your funds and personal information. Strong passwords are the first line of defense. Use a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ols, and avoid using easily guessable information such as your birthday or pet’s name.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) whenever possible, which adds an extra layer of security by requiring a code from your phone or email in addition to your password.
- Strong Passwords: Create complex and unique passwords for each online account.
- Two-Factor Authentication: Enable 2FA whenever available for enhanced security.
- Phishing Awareness: Be cautious of suspicious emails or messages requesting your login details.
- Secure Network: Avoid using public Wi-Fi networks when accessing your casino account.
Recognizing and Avoiding Phishing Scams
Phishing scams are a common tactic used by cybercriminals to steal sensitive information. These scams often involve fraudulent emails or messages that appear to be from legitimate sources, such as the casino or a payment processor. These messages may ask you to click on a link and enter your login details, or they may request personal information such as your credit card number. Be extremely wary of any unsolicited emails or messages requesting sensitive information, and never click on links from untrusted sources.
| Suspicious Email Address | The sender’s email address doesn’t match the official domain of the casino. | Verify the sender’s email address carefully before opening the message. |
| Poor Grammar and Spelling | The email contains numerous grammatical errors and spelling mistakes. | Be cautious of poorly written emails, as they are often a sign of phishing. |
| Urgent Requests | The email creates a sense of urgency, pressuring you to act immediately. | Don’t be rushed into making any decisions. Take your time and verify the information. |
| Requests for Personal Information | The email asks you to provide sensitive information such as your password or credit card number. | Never share your personal information via email. |
Remember, a legitimate casino will never ask you for your password or credit card details via email. If you are unsure about the legitimacy of an email, it’s always best to contact the casino directly through their official website or customer support channels.
